Historical development of Empower s/n calculations When Empower 2 was released in May 2005, USP had not yet defined any s/n calculations. 7 With USP 31 NF 26 (effective May 1, 2008 - April 30, 2009), there was no s/n formula in the guidelines. However, beginning with USP 32 NF 27 (effective May 1, …

WebIn Empower 2, the USP S/N calculation is best determined through the use of a custom field. The equivalent to the USP S/N formula of 2h/hn is as follows in Empower 2: USP S/N = 2*Height*Scale to µV/(Blank.1.SAME(Peak to Peak Noise)) Figure 2 shows this formula and the appropriate custom field parameters in the Empower 2 Edit Custom Field window. WebWhen Empower 2 was released in May 2005, USP had not yet defined any s/n calculations. With USP 31 NF 26 (effective May 1, 2008 - April 30, 2009), there was no s/n formula in the guidelines. However, beginning with USP 32 NF 27 (effective May 1, 2009 – April 30, 2010), USP defined the s/n formula as 2H/n. WebSep 16, 2008 · S/N = 2h/hn, where h is "the height of the peak corresponding to the component concerned" and hn is "the difference between the largest and smallest noise values observed over a distance equal to at least five times the width at the half-height of the peak and, if possible, situated equally around the peak of interest."

WebEP Signal-to-Noise Calculation in Empower 2 The EP S/N calculation in Empower 2 is as close as possible to the EP definition, while not requiring a separate blank injection. The formula is as follows: EP S/N = 2 x (H – ½ PPNoise / Scaling) / (PPNoise / Scaling) where: H = The absolute value of the height of the peak
